FREEDOM
By Jonathan Franzen.
Farrar, Straus & Giroux, $28.
The author of The Corrections is back, not quite adecade later, with an even richer and deeper work a
vividly realized narrative set during the Bush years, when
the creedal legacy of personal liberties assumed new
and sometimes ominous proportions. Franzen captures
this through the tribulations of a Midwestern family, the
Berglunds, whose successes, failures and appetite forself-invention reflect the larger story of millennial
America.
THE NEW YORKER STORIES
By Ann Beattie.
Scribner, $30.
As these 48 stories published in The New Yorker from
1974 through 2006 demonstrate, Beattie, even as she
chronicled and satirized her post-1960s generation, also
became its defining voice. She punctures her characters
pretensions and jadedness with an economy and
effortless dialogue that writers have been trying to
emulate for three decades, though few, if any, have
matched her seamless combination of biting wit and
mordant humor, precise irony and consummate cool.

SELECTED STORIES
By William Trevor.
Viking, $35.
Gathering work from Trevors previous four collections, this volume shows why his
deceptively spare fiction has haunted and moved readers for generations. Set mainly in
Ireland and England, Trevors tales are eloquent even in their silences, documenting the
way the present is consumed by the past, the way ancient patterns shape the future.
Neither modernist nor antique, his stories are timeless.
A VISIT FROM THE GOON SQUAD
By Jennifer Egan.
Alfred A. Knopf, $25.95.
Time is the goon squad in this virtuosic rock n roll novel about a cynical record
producer and the people who intersect his world. Ranging across some 40 years and
inhabiting 13 different characters, each with his own story and perspective, Egan makes
these disparate parts cohere into an artful whole, irradiated by a Proustian feel for loss,
regret and the ravages of love.

CLEOPATRA: A Life
By Stacy Schiff.
Little, Brown & Company, $29.99.
With her signature blend of wit, intelligence and superb prose, Schiff strips away 2,000
years of prejudices and propaganda in her elegant reimagining of the Egyptian queen
who, even in her own day, was mythologized and misrepresented.
THE EMPEROR OF ALL MALADIES: A Biography of Cancer
By Siddhartha Mukherjee.
Scribner, $30.
Mukherjees magisterial biography of the most dreaded of modern afflictions. He
excavates the deep history of the war on cancer, weaving haunting tales of his own
clinical experience with sharp sketches of the sometimes heroic, sometimes misguided
scientists who have preceded him in the fight.
FINISHING THE HAT: Collected Lyrics (1954-1981) With Attendant
Comments, Principles, Heresies, Grudges, Whines and Anecdotes
By Stephen Sondheim.Alfred A. Knopf, $39.95.
The theaters pre-eminent living songwriter offers a master class in how to write a
musical, covering some of the greatest shows, from West Side Story to Sweeney
Todd. Sondheims analysis of his and others lyrics is insightful and candid, and his
anecdotes are telling and often very funny.
